Dr. Nicole A. Heal is an Assistant Professor in the Behavior Analysis and Therapy Program in the Rehabilitation Institute. She received her Ph.D. (2007) in Behavioral Psychology and an M.A. (2005) in Human Development and Family Life from the University of Kansas, and a B.S. (2000) in Early Childhood Special Education from the University of Maine at Farmington.

She is also a Board Certified Behavior Analyst. Dr. Heal is currently an editorial board member for the Journal of Organizational Behavior Management and serves as a guest reviewer for the Journal of Applied Behavior Analysis and Behavior Analysis in Practice. Her research interests include designing efficacious and preferred educational environments for young children with and without developmental disabilities, the extension and refinement of preference assessments at the individual and group level, and assessment and treatment of problem behavior. Dr. Heal is the 2008 recipient of the Society for the Experimental Analysis of Behavior Applied Dissertation Award given by Division 25 of the American Psychological Association.

BAT Travels North to Chicago

Beginning in 2009 SIU is proud to offer the Masters Degree in Behavior Analysis and Therapy in the Chicago/Joliet area.  SIUC, in a partnership with Trinity Services, Inc., will deliver the degree program over a three year period.
